v2.3.0-alpha2
Pre-release
Pre-release
maayarosama
released this
10 Dec 17:48
·
3393 commits
to development
since this release
What's Changed
- Twin Page in Playground by @AlaaElattar in #1043
- Add prefix routing by @zaelgohary in #1053
- Add Edit button in twin details page. by @AlaaElattar in #1051
- change alert from warning to info by @AlaaElattar in #1117
- Make it clear for creating account by @AlaaElattar in #1114
- Adding max validation to dedicate node filter inputs by @AlaaElattar in #1108
- update cards ui by @samaradel in #1088
- Add gridproxy_client package by @AlaaElattar in #1104
- Add package for graphql client by @AlaaElattar in #1105
- Support reload balance by @MohamedElmdary in #1123
- Development 312 dashboard transfer by @amiraabouhadid in #1076
- Support nodes gpu filter by @MohamedElmdary in #1125
- Edit navigation drawer to include dashboard by @zaelgohary in #1040
- Add support for missing status in gridproxy client by @MohamedElmdary in #1132
- Implement Bridge in playground in Vue3 by @AlaaElattar in #1077
- Development 312 dashboard minting by @samaradel in #1083
- Add Get TFT button in new Dashboard by @AlaaElattar in #1086
- add dao module in tfchain client and tfgrid client by @amiraabouhadid in #1089
- Remove css conflict with toolbar by @AlaaElattar in #1134
- added resource pricing by @maayarosama in #1078
- Adding stats page to playground by @maayarosama in #1063
- Development 313 layout fixes by @zaelgohary in #1138
- support load twin and fix type issue in load node byId in gridProxy client by @MohamedElmdary in #1140
- fixing routes for explorer and calculator by @maayarosama in #1142
- Define node filters component to be re-usable by @Mahmoud-Emad in #1156
- Add dao to playground by @amiraabouhadid in #1139
- Update wrong import. by @Mahmoud-Emad in #1167
- Add support to load gpu cards of a node in gridproxy by @MohamedElmdary in #1171
- Change info messages color to green by @AlaaElattar in #1190
- Fix Error message appearance in bridge by @AlaaElattar in #1191
- Make all toasts compatible by @AlaaElattar in #1153
- Update Grafana to Monitoring by @AlaaElattar in #1194
- Fix
custom_toast
component by @AlaaElattar in #1195 - Make the view of the all pages consistent with new Themes by @ehab-hassan in #1184
- Update default value of withdraw to 2 tft by @AlaaElattar in #1198
- Add Copy Icon next to address in Twin page. by @AlaaElattar in #1193
- Add TFT-USD exchange rate by @AlaaElattar in #1093
- add missing bracket in App.vue by @AlaaElattar in #1200
- rename Zero-os-bootstrap to 0-bootstrap by @AlaaElattar in #1218
- Development 313 dashboard explorer nodes by @Mahmoud-Emad in #1129
- Add tooltip message for
Get TFT
button by @AlaaElattar in #1216 - Fix free public ips by @AlaaElattar in #1217
- [Transfer] fix validation bug. by @AlaaElattar in #1221
- Changed wrong return type in requestNodes function. by @Mahmoud-Emad in #1224
- Adding simulator to playground by @maayarosama in #1131
- Development 313 simulator update by @maayarosama in #1228
- fix tft conversion by @mohamedamer453 in #1231
- Flat
other services
out. by @AlaaElattar in #1243 - Expose all and filter methods on the nodes module to list/filter all nodes by @Mahmoud-Emad in #1238
- Fix Bug in pricing calculator by @AlaaElattar in #1233
- Dedicated Nodes in vue3 by @AlaaElattar in #1180
- Fix workflow
Heap out of memory
by @AlaaElattar in #1246 - adding grid services link by @mohamedamer453 in #1232
- Dev 313 add dao popup by @amiraabouhadid in #1165
- Add background color to light mode by @AlaaElattar in #1250
- Enhancements at Nodes Explorer UI by @Mahmoud-Emad in #1249
- Development 313 Gql contracts interface by @Mahmoud-Emad in #1255
- Add Destination relay in error msg by @AlaaElattar in #1259
- Show failed deployment names in listing table by @AlaaElattar in #1248
- replace password tooltip with a hint by @mohamedamer453 in #1264
- Development 313 offline nodes notifacation by @Mahmoud-Emad in #1239
- loading doesn't stop if the node is not responding by @Mahmoud-Emad in #1242
- updated the return type of the pricing calculator by @mohamedamer453 in #1273
- Development 313 enhancements by @Mahmoud-Emad in #1272
- Fix the gqlConsumption issue. by @Mahmoud-Emad in #1280
- Development 313 enhance ui2 by @ehab-hassan in #1266
- Removed no needed new variable, removed no needed ! mark. by @Mahmoud-Emad in #1292
- fix the none package condition by @mohamedamer453 in #1298
- Stats website in vue3 by @0oM4R in #1234
- Development 313 failed deployments fix by @maayarosama in #1268
- change solution flavors names by @0oM4R in #1345
- Resolve 3.13 conflicts with 3.12 by @AhmedHanafy725 in #1350
- add dockerfile and chart for new stats by @hossnys in #1304
- Fix typo in error message by @AhmedHanafy725 in #1372
- add loading page by @mohamedamer453 in #1321
- fix nodes field infinite loading by @mohamedamer453 in #1374
- Increase memory in recommended to 16 GB by @AlaaElattar in #1362
- Remove dialogue persistent by @zaelgohary in #1368
- separate nework errors and storage pools errors by @mohamedamer453 in #1383
- Fix duplicate contracts when deleting by @AlaaElattar in #1381
- [Dedicated nodes] add switch to filter only nodes with GPU by @0oM4R in #1376
- handle delete deployment errors by @0oM4R in #1386
- Total Cost of contracts per hour and month by @AlaaElattar in #1391
- Support hex based seed by @MohamedElmdary in #1380
- fix ttl creation in rmb rmb client by @0oM4R in #1402
- updated toast colors by @ehab-hassan in #1405
- Add back button to solutions page by @AlaaElattar in #1349
- available farms randomization by @0oM4R in #1370
- fix sorting by @mohamedamer453 in #1348
- Add portal/farms by @zaelgohary in #1154
- Change route to dedicated nodes instead of old dashboard by @AlaaElattar in #1426
- Fix deployment error
maybe it's rented by another user or node is dedicated.
by @AlaaElattar in #1425 - Development 313 login UI color by @ehab-hassan in #1346
- handle loading contracts error by @0oM4R in #1392
- 🔥 Hotfix: fix this binding in migration internal method by @MohamedElmdary in #1432
- Introduce error types in tfchain client by @0oM4R in #1417
- Adding a new card for dedicated nodes by @maayarosama in #1435
- Add node type column by @zaelgohary in #1431
- Fix build workflows errors by @0oM4R in #1437
- updating scripts structure by @mohamedamer453 in #1409
- Use error types in graphql client by @0oM4R in #1440
- Use error types in RMB direct client by @0oM4R in #1433
- Adding a certified chip and loading all nodes regardless of filters a… by @maayarosama in #1366
- Search farm by name by @zaelgohary in #1422
- fix the unwanted behavior in the secondary navbar by @mohamedamer453 in #1447
- Fix Playground in custom mode by @zaelgohary in #1446
- consistent closing of non solution deleting dialogs by @amiraabouhadid in #1448
- Fix config URL by @zaelgohary in #1460
- explorer farms by @samaradel in #1240
- fix liner error by @amiraabouhadid in #1466
- use error classes grid client by @0oM4R in #1443
- Fix websocket typo by @zaelgohary in #1510
- add documentation for types/errors by @0oM4R in #1471
- [explorer] Change farms total ips filter to free ips filter by @0oM4R in #1523
- Make config public in modules to be exist for the check balance decorator by @AhmedHanafy725 in #1525
- fix hint and typos in transfer page by @0oM4R in #1511
- Fix getting user nodes in portal by @0oM4R in #1507
- add relay hint by @mohamedamer453 in #1509
- Handle custom network in dashboard by @0oM4R in #1465
- Development 313 revamp sidebar by @amiraabouhadid in #1464
- release v2.2.0 rc6 by @0oM4R in #1546
- show minting on all networks by @mohamedamer453 in #1553
- Reorder network switches by @zaelgohary in #1554
- Fix typos by @zaelgohary in #1550
- update tooltip icon for clickable icons by @mohamedamer453 in #1555
- disable loading after the details are loaded by @mohamedamer453 in #1558
- update formatting of dao details by @mohamedamer453 in #1551
- Fix fetching deployments by @MohamedElmdary in #1557
- Fix virtual machine domains by @MohamedElmdary in #1552
- reorder sidebar by @mohamedamer453 in #1576
- Development 313 fix farms filter & enhance farm table by @amiraabouhadid in #1563
- Development 313 fix stat cards by @amiraabouhadid in #1564
- Fix uptime in dashboard nodes by @0oM4R in #1582
- Node Filters by @Mahmoud-Emad in #1580
- Development 3.13 by @AhmedHanafy725 in #1126
- add nodesOwnedBy and refactor user_nodes by @mohamedamer453 in #1572
- add close button to manage domains dialog by @amiraabouhadid in #1596
- Update max farm name to be 40 chars by @AlaaElattar in #1608
- change contracts list path in notification by @0oM4R in #1613
- Update the v-server, enable cors by @Mahmoud-Emad in #1548
- change deposit dialog layout by @0oM4R in #1610
- Manual node Id selection by @maayarosama in #1207
- fix responsive twin page issue by @0oM4R in #1620
- Fix tooltip color and others by @ehab-hassan in #1626
- move close buttons to the left by @mohamedamer453 in #1622
- fix typo in the warning message and improve font size by @mohamedamer453 in #1617
- Development 313 minting by @maayarosama in #1573
- Add Back Button in second navbar by @AlaaElattar in #1623
- Formatting dao proposal's card by @maayarosama in #1559
- make farm id filter filter in nodes compatible with one in farms page by @AlaaElattar in #1631
- renaming dashboard farms to your farms to avoid confusion by @maayarosama in #1633
- Improve select node by @MohamedElmdary in #1457
- Developemnt 313 mass deployment by @AlaaElattar in #1421
- Filter out the undefined extrinsics by @AhmedHanafy725 in #1637
- make types package public by @0oM4R in #1639
New Contributors
Full Changelog: v2.2.0-rc6...v2.3.0-alpha2